To filter 18+ content on Google, turn on SafeSearch. Go to Google Search settings, enable SafeSearch, and save the settings. This will help block explicit content from your search results, creating a safer browsing experience.

  1. What is Google SafeSearch and how does it work? Google SafeSearch is a feature that filters out explicit and adult content from search results to provide a safer browsing experience.
  2. Can SafeSearch be turned off if I want to see all types of content? Yes, SafeSearch can be disabled by going to Google Search settings and toggling off the SafeSearch filter.
  3. Does enabling SafeSearch block all adult content on Google? SafeSearch helps filter most explicit content but may not catch everything; it significantly reduces the chances of adult content appearing.
  4. Is SafeSearch available on all devices? SafeSearch settings are available across all devices where you use Google Search, including desktops, smartphones, and tablets.
